End of Spring Break
My Outreach Coordinator has been nagging at me to start a blog. I'm not too sure about this, but I'll give it a whirl. First, let me introduce myself. My name is Isabelle. I'm a Chevy Equinox with a new soul. The team of students here at the University of Tulsa have spent the past couple of years modifying me. I don't remember too much from before they gutted me, but they sure keep me busy these days!
My students just came back from Spring Break. A few of them hung around with me and worked on my brain. (They call it the cRio--what do they know?) I do seem to be feeling a lot better lately. My hybrid mode works fairly well. I still seem to have a "hitch in my gitalong" as my grandpappy used to say. I hope they can get me fixed up pretty soon.
